LAKEVIEW HOSPITAL NAMES BEN RICHAUD AS NEW CHIEF EXECUTIVE OFFICER

Northshore native returns home to Covington to lead award-winning hospital

NEW ORLEANS – Lakeview Hospital, now part of LCMC Health, is pleased to announce the appointment of Benjamin “Ben” Richaud, MSHA, MBA as its new Chief Executive Officer.

With more than ten years of experience in healthcare management, Richaud has a strong background in hospital operations, strategic planning, and financial management. He has served in various leadership positions throughout his career, including his most recent role as Chief Executive Officer of Baptist Medical Center, a 603-bed, flagship hospital within the Baptist Health System (Tenet Healthcare) located in San Antonio, TX.

In his new role at Lakeview Hospital, Richaud will be responsible for overseeing the hospital’s operations, leading the development of strategic initiatives, and ensuring the delivery of high-quality care to patients on the Northshore.

“Ben is a respected healthcare leader with more than a decade of senior leadership experience,” said Greg Feirn, CEO of LCMC Health. “His strategic vision and commitment to patient-centered care make him an ideal fit for Lakeview Hospital. We are thrilled to welcome Ben the LCMC Health family.”

Lakeview Hospital is a 167-bed, full-service hospital serving patients from across St. Tammany Parish, including Lacombe, Abita Springs, Madisonville, Covington, Mandeville, Slidell, and beyond. The hospital offers a wide range of medical services, including a 24/7 Emergency Room, a Heart Center, a Surgical Institute, a Rehabilitation Center, and a Behavioral Health Center.

“As a Northshore native, I am honored to have the opportunity to lead the exceptional team at Lakeview Hospital,” said Richaud. “I look forward to working with the talented staff and physicians to continue building upon the hospital’s strong reputation as a leading provider of healthcare services in the region.”

Richaud holds a Master of Science in Healthcare Administration and a Master of Business Administration from the University of Alabama at Birmingham. He also holds a Bachelor of Arts in Communication from the University of Alabama at Tuscaloosa.
